I agree with using Google Satellite view and I also use Google street view when it is available. One thing that Google Satellite does not do is update real time so you do not know how many people are parked along the curbs restricting the flow of traffic into and out of the pumps. I would use that pilot when we had the Class C Sunseeker which was 28 foot but wouldn't dream of using it with the Challenger. There is another Pilot at exit 205 where the. pumps are parallel to the road and it provides better access for larger motorhomes and 5th wheels.

As a note the Loves at 213 has been operational for quite some time.

I use a Garmin DriveSmart 61. Although not the latest and greatest, it has some features I find useful.

Trip Planner feature
On longer unfamiliar routes off the beaten path I use the "avoid road" function to customize the route - something you cannot do on Google Maps. The caveat is on longer trips this can take a considerable amount of time. I usually sit down at the computer with Google maps open and scroll/pan through the route ESPECIALLY at intersections/turns onto minor roads. As stated in posts above, Garmin routing will randomly take bizarre routes... I've been routed onto some scary single-lane roads more than once! By "pre-planning" with Google Maps, I also scan for fuel stops to get a TRUE VISUAL on what I'm pulling in to. I really don't fancy disconnecting the toad just to turn around!

Speed - both actual and posted
In the lower left corner there's a little "speed limit sign" showing the posted speed... Garmin sounds a tone when approaching a speed change. Beside that is your ACTUAL speed. As others have posted, I CANNOT see my dash instruments AT ALL in sunlight (THANKS FORD). Besides, the factory speedo IS NOT ACCURATE... and I'm certainly not paying a Ford dealer $$$ to recalibrate.

Garmin likely uses the same mapping algorithm across all it's models. The differences are specific to firmware in certain models - which essentially do route avoidance based on what you program in - basically "somewhat" automating what I do manually with Google Maps.

A side note: When navigating with a large vehicle like an RV, I urge using as many tools as possible to avoid the feeling of "I'm not really sure where I'm going...". Search for useful RV apps, and do a little research. Your GPS is just one tool among many. No two people travel/plan the same way. I'm an information junkie... I like to have all the details BEFORE I start a trip in the RV. That my drive others nuts. Point is, find what works for YOU!

I'm curious why you don't like the RV Life app anymore? I just signed up for a trial of it. Going on our first trip in our new motorhome this week.
At first we loved it because it was the only RV based HPS that did not have a defective database. Plus it's integration with Trip Wizard made it a winner in our eyes.

After we used it several times, we noticed things that are just flat out annoying.

The user unterface is about 12 years behind.

It is easy to back out of the app while using it by mistake and have to reroute the trip.

The screen does not rotate.

It is horrible at estimating time. It can be off by as much as 50%.

There are bings and bongs above the speed limit which cannot be turned off.

The voice is really bad.

The text field t the top of the screen does not allow enough characters to give the full not of an exit.

It will identify splits in the road that are not exits as exits and direct you to make unnecessary lane changes.

There are more, just what I can think of off the top of my head. The Teip Wizard is still our primary planner, we don't use their maintenance app.

I think Truck Map is a suitable free replacement.
